West Virginia Court Appointed Special Advocates Association, Inc. (CASA)
Project Name:
Children Caught in the Wake of the West Virginia Opioid Crisis
Award Received:
$279,812.91
Visit their website:
Award Summary:
Funds are being used to expand volunteer recruitment, training, and support services for children impacted by the opioid crisis. The project enhances case management, data collection, and community outreach to strengthen individualized advocacy, early intervention, and family support. By building volunteer capacity, the initiative ensures more children receive the care and stability they need.
